> Roger Breton wrote:
>> 30 to 60 Grid points? In which table, if I may ask?
>
> Either the forward table (maybe up to 33), or the reverse table in the case
> of the larger numbers. Anything up to 5 or 10 million grid locations isn't
> completely out of the question, if you're willing to wait long enough.
>

Have you ever investigated how much of a spread does interpolation by the
CMM fares compared to building extra nodes into the B2A table? I suspect
there is a point of diminishing return where, beyond a certain number of
nodes, there isn't anything to be gained in actual extra precision in the
results.
